Stay informed about CVE-2022-40806 involving a code-execution backdoor in the d8s-uuids Python package on PyPI version 0.1.0. Learn impacts, mitigation, and prevention steps.
The CVE-2022-40806, involving the d8s-uuids package for Python, distributed on PyPI, has a potential code-execution backdoor inserted by a third party, specifically the democritus-hypothesis package version 0.1.0.
Understanding CVE-2022-40806
This section provides insights into the nature and impacts of the CVE-2022-40806 vulnerability.
What is CVE-2022-40806?
The CVE-2022-40806 vulnerability exists in the d8s-uuids Python package available on PyPI, where a code-execution backdoor, in the form of the democritus-hypothesis package, was covertly inserted, affecting version 0.1.0.
The Impact of CVE-2022-40806
The inclusion of the backdoor can potentially allow threat actors to execute arbitrary code on systems utilizing the affected version, leading to unauthorized access and compromise of sensitive data.
Technical Details of CVE-2022-40806
This section delves into the specific technical aspects of the CVE-2022-40806 vulnerability.
Vulnerability Description
The vulnerability stems from the malicious insertion of a code-execution backdoor within the d8s-uuids Python package, brought in through the democritus-hypothesis package.
Affected Systems and Versions
Systems utilizing the d8s-uuids Python package with version 0.1.0 are vulnerable to this exploit, potentially exposing them to unauthorized code execution.
Exploitation Mechanism
Threat actors can exploit this vulnerability by leveraging the malicious code present in the democritus-hypothesis package to execute arbitrary commands on the target system.
Mitigation and Prevention
This section provides guidance on mitigating the risks associated with CVE-2022-40806.
Immediate Steps to Take
Users are advised to cease using version 0.1.0 of the d8s-uuids Python package and remove it from their systems immediately to prevent any potential exploitation.
Long-Term Security Practices
Implementing strong security practices, such as regular code reviews, monitoring for unauthorized changes, and ensuring the integrity of third-party packages, can help prevent similar backdoor insertions in the future.
Patching and Updates
It is crucial to update to a patched version of the d8s-uuids package once the vendor releases a secure update to address the vulnerability.